As this is uk.d-i-y I feel compelled to point out that if the cooling plate
is cold but the fridge stays warm it's probably just the door seal not
sealing properly. Either the door is twisted (just apply twisting force to
repair) or the seal is simply knackered (buy a new one and fit). No way to
fix it with an angle grinder that I know of.
